What is the Central and Local Information Partnership – Finance or CLIP-F ?
The Central and Local Information Partnership – Finance or CLIP-F is a consultative subgroup of CLIP which considers the collection, presentation and analysis of data on local government finance.
This group was previously known as the Working Group on Local Government Financial Statistics or WGLGFS. Information on WGLGFS, including papers from previous meetings is available from the WGLGFS home page
The membership consists of representatives from central government departments, local government, CIPFA and the Audit Commission, and generally meets three times a year usually in July, November and January.
